EMC — IEC 61000-Series and IEC 62920 Evidence for PV Inverters in Namibia Projects Chinese PV inverter EMC evidence may be based on GB/T 37408-2021, NB/T 32004, and test reports issued by Chinese laboratories. These reports may use IEC 61000-family methods, but China-side certification does not automatically prove IEC 62920 compliance for a Namibia project or satisfy a NamPower, RED, lender, or EPC documentation checklist. The relevant report should match the exact model, rating, firmware, port configuration, and operating mode supplied.GB/T 37408-2021 — 光伏并网逆变器技术要求 (Technical Requirements for Photovoltaic Grid-Connected Inverters)
NB/T 32004 — 光伏并网逆变器技术规范 (Technical Specification for Photovoltaic Grid-Connected Inverters)
Namibia PV inverter EMC acceptance should be built around the project specification, NSI-adopted standards where applicable, and the requirements of NamPower, the relevant RED, municipality, lender, or EPC. IEC 62920 is the dedicated EMC standard for photovoltaic power conversion equipment, while IEC 61000-series standards provide common immunity, emission, harmonic, and flicker test methods and limits. For grid-tied inverters, EMC is not only a product-label issue; it affects power quality, harmonics, protection coordination, and utility acceptance.IEC 62920 — Photovoltaic power generating systems — EMC requirements and test methods for power conversion equipment
IEC 61000 series — Electromagnetic compatibility test methods and limits, including harmonic current emissions and immunity requirements where applicable
NSI conformity expectations for Namibian standards adopting or referencing IEC standards
NamPower/RED/project-owner power-quality and grid-connection specifications
Gap: GB/T or NB/T EMC reports are useful background evidence but should not be treated as a complete Namibia acceptance package. Exporters should obtain or map IEC 62920 and applicable IEC 61000-series reports, verify laboratory accreditation and model coverage, and confirm with the connecting utility or EPC whether harmonics, flicker, immunity, and conducted/radiated emissions must be retested under Namibia 50 Hz 220/380 V operating settings.[INFORMATIONAL] Do not rely on a China-only EMC certificate as Namibia project evidence. Map the file to IEC 62920 and the applicable IEC 61000-series tests, confirm model and firmware coverage, and ask NamPower, the relevant RED, municipality, EPC, or lender whether Namibia 50 Hz 220/380 V settings require additional power-quality or EMC testing. Namibia Grid-Connection Gates — NSI Conformity, ECB Licensing, NamPower/RED Connection, IEC 62116, IEC 61727, and 50 Hz / 220 V / 380 V Settings Chinese grid-connection evidence commonly includes GB/T 19964-2024, NB/T 32004, GB/T 37408-2021, domestic anti-islanding reports, and factory grid-code settings for China. Those documents are based on Chinese regulatory acceptance and Chinese grid-connection practice. They do not create approval by NSI, ECB, NamPower, or a Namibian RED and should not be presented as a substitute for Namibia project acceptance without IEC test evidence and Namibia-specific firmware validation.GB/T 19964-2024 — 光伏发电站接入电力系统技术规定 (Technical Requirements for Connecting Photovoltaic Power Station to Power System)
NB/T 32004 — 光伏并网逆变器技术规范 (Technical Specification for Photovoltaic Grid-Connected Inverters)
GB/T 37408-2021 — 光伏并网逆变器技术要求 (Technical Requirements for Photovoltaic Grid-Connected Inverters)
Grid-tied solar PV inverters for Namibia must be treated as project-specific equipment, not as automatically accepted consumer electronics. The practical approval chain is NSI conformity where Namibian standards adopt or reference IEC standards, ECB licensing or regulatory treatment for generation, supply, IPP, and net-metering projects, and connection approval by NamPower or the relevant Regional Electricity Distributor such as CENORED or Erongo RED. Namibia uses a 50 Hz low-voltage supply commonly described as 220/380 V, so inverter firmware, voltage and frequency trip thresholds, reconnection timing, anti-islanding behaviour, and utility-interface functions should be validated for Namibian settings. IEC 62116 anti-islanding and IEC 61727 utility-interface evidence are core grid-connection documents for grid-tied PV inverters.IEC 62116 — Utility-interconnected photovoltaic inverters — Test procedure of islanding prevention measures
IEC 61727 — Photovoltaic systems — Characteristics of the utility interface
ECB licensing and regulatory treatment for electricity generation, supply, IPP, and net-metering projects
NamPower or relevant Regional Electricity Distributor connection approval for grid-tied systems
Namibia low-voltage grid context commonly stated as 220/380 V, 50 Hz
Gap: China-side GB/T and NB/T evidence does not satisfy the Namibia approval chain by itself. Exporters should prepare IEC 62116 anti-islanding reports, IEC 61727 utility-interface evidence, a documented Namibia grid-code setting file for 50 Hz 220/380 V operation, and project documentation for the ECB and NamPower/RED review path. Where grid parameters differ from the Chinese factory default, the setting change should be controlled, recorded, and retested if required by the utility or project engineer.[INFORMATIONAL] Treat NSI conformity, ECB licensing or regulatory treatment, and NamPower/RED connection approval as separate Namibia gates. Chinese GB/T 19964-2024, NB/T 32004, and GB/T 37408-2021 documents do not automatically satisfy IEC 62116, IEC 61727, or Namibia utility acceptance. Validate the inverter configuration for Namibia's 50 Hz 220/380 V network before project submission. NamPower (Namibia Power Corporation)2026-06-14 · unverified
Namibia Solar Market Context — Modified Single Buyer, IPP/Utility-Scale Projects, Rooftop Net Metering, Import Dependence, and Green Hydrogen China domestic acceptance may include Chinese grid-code certificates, voluntary CQC or CGC inverter certification, and project-owner approvals under Chinese utility practice. These documents can help demonstrate manufacturing maturity but are not Namibia market-entry approvals. For Namibian IPP, NamPower, RED, rooftop, or hydrogen-linked projects, the acceptance package should be rebuilt around the Namibian regulator, the connecting utility, and project finance specifications.GB/T 37408-2021 — 光伏并网逆变器技术要求 (Technical Requirements for Photovoltaic Grid-Connected Inverters)
NB/T 32004 — 光伏并网逆变器技术规范 (Technical Specification for Photovoltaic Grid-Connected Inverters)
GB/T 19964-2024 — 光伏发电站接入电力系统技术规定 (Technical Requirements for Connecting Photovoltaic Power Station to Power System)
Namibia has some of the world's strongest solar resources and is using solar PV to reduce heavy electricity import dependence, including imports historically sourced from South Africa's Eskom and regional power pools. Market access is project-driven: utility-scale projects, IPPs under the modified single-buyer framework, NamPower procurement, RED or municipal distribution projects, and rooftop net-metering installations can each impose different documentation routes. Green-hydrogen ambitions increase the importance of bankable IEC documentation because large renewable generation and electrolysis projects often use lender and offtaker technical specifications in addition to national approval gates.ECB regulation of electricity generation, transmission, distribution, supply, import, and export licensing
NamPower procurement and connection processes for national utility projects
Regional Electricity Distributor and municipal distribution connection requirements
Project-owner, lender, and offtaker specifications for IPP, utility-scale solar, and green-hydrogen-linked renewable generation
Gap: Namibia's solar push does not mean automatic inverter acceptance. The supplier should identify the exact route first: NamPower utility-scale procurement, IPP PPA, RED or municipal distribution connection, rooftop net metering, or hydrogen-linked renewable supply. Each route can require separate model approvals, grid studies, protection settings, commissioning tests, and documentation from IEC laboratories.[INFORMATIONAL] Namibia's strong solar resource, import-reduction policy drivers, modified single-buyer market, rooftop net-metering activity, and green-hydrogen ambitions make solar attractive, but they do not remove the approval gates. Confirm the exact ECB, NamPower, RED, municipal, lender, and offtaker route before relying on any China-side inverter certificate. Electricity Control Board of Namibia2026-06-14 · unverified
IEC 62109-1 / IEC 62109-2 Safety Evidence — NSI Conformity and Namibia Project Acceptance Chinese safety evidence commonly includes GB/T 37408-2021, NB/T 32004, voluntary CQC or CGC certification, and factory test documentation. These can show China-side product testing but do not automatically satisfy IEC 62109-1/-2 or Namibia project acceptance. A Namibia project may require third-party IEC reports from an accredited laboratory covering the exact inverter model or model family.GB/T 37408-2021 — 光伏并网逆变器技术要求 (Technical Requirements for Photovoltaic Grid-Connected Inverters)
NB/T 32004 — 光伏并网逆变器技术规范 (Technical Specification for Photovoltaic Grid-Connected Inverters)
For solar PV inverters supplied to Namibia, IEC 62109-1 and IEC 62109-2 are the central international safety references for power converters used in photovoltaic power systems. Namibia project acceptance should confirm whether NSI-adopted Namibian standards, the ECB regulatory route, NamPower or RED connection conditions, EPC specifications, or lender requirements call for IEC 62109 certificates or test reports. IEC 62109-2 covers inverter-specific safety requirements and is assessed together with IEC 62109-1 general requirements.IEC 62109-1 — Safety of power converters for use in photovoltaic power systems — Part 1: General requirements
IEC 62109-2 — Safety of power converters for use in photovoltaic power systems — Part 2: Particular requirements for inverters
NSI conformity expectations where Namibian standards adopt or reference IEC standards
ECB, NamPower, RED, EPC, and lender project documentation requirements
Gap: China-side GB/T safety files are not a direct substitute for IEC 62109-1/-2 evidence. Exporters should obtain IEC 62109-1/-2 certificates or type-test reports for the inverter model, confirm model-family coverage, verify that DC input voltage, AC output rating, enclosure/IP rating, firmware, and intended installation environment are covered, and align the evidence with the NSI, ECB, NamPower/RED, EPC, and lender review path.[INFORMATIONAL] A PV inverter with only China-side GB/T or NB/T safety evidence should not be treated as accepted for Namibia. Build the safety file around IEC 62109-1/-2, confirm NSI conformity expectations, and align the model coverage with the ECB, NamPower/RED, EPC, lender, and project-owner review route before shipment.
